DadWare is a company from Los Angeles, CA, that makes a shirt that looks kind of like a breast feeding shirt but... for men.

Inspired by doing skin-on-skin bonding when his baby was born, this entrepreneural father wants to help encourage other men to perform skin-on-skin contact with their babies by inventing a shirt with an opening babies can be kind of... stuffed into.

As... cute(?) as the idea might be, the sharks just weren't biting, not even Robert who likes to bring up his young twins for just about anything and this entrepreneur left the tank without a deal.
